Output 38950cfc5d93e2bf9800546b0b59cd4b101a2180845b1fd7bc599733ff300f2a:0

value
352874
script pubkey
OP_0 OP_PUSHBYTES_20 8bbea221c043c85823f106b8e41401f409aa17e5
address
bc1q3wl2ygwqg0y9sgl3q6uwg9qp7sy659l9ectsju
transaction
38950cfc5d93e2bf9800546b0b59cd4b101a2180845b1fd7bc599733ff300f2a
confirmations
152021
spent
true